Fmoc-2-nitro-L-phenylalanine is widely utilized in research focused on:
- Peptide Synthesis: This compound serves as a key building block in the synthesis of peptides, particularly in solid-phase peptide synthesis, allowing for the introduction of nitro groups that can be further modified.
- Drug Development: Its unique properties make it valuable in the pharmaceutical industry for developing new drugs, especially those targeting specific biological pathways involving nitroaromatic compounds.
- Bioconjugation: The nitro group can be used for selective bioconjugation reactions, facilitating the attachment of biomolecules to surfaces or other molecules, which is crucial in creating targeted therapies.
- Research in Chemical Biology: It is employed in studies exploring the interactions between peptides and proteins, helping researchers understand mechanisms of action in biological systems.
- Fluorescent Probes: The compound can be modified to create fluorescent probes for imaging applications, enhancing the visualization of cellular processes in live cells.
